If there were a quarterly (3x/year) glossy magazine written in English (maybe $8-10 at newsstands, discounted for subscribers) that featured Korean soap stars, dramas and entertainment articles, would you be willing to purchase or subscribe to it?
Yes, sign me up!
51%
 51%  [ 36 ]
No, I don't think I'd be interested.
2%
 2%  [ 2 ]
I might buy it from the newsstand if it had great articles and pics.
30%
 30%  [ 21 ]
If I saw it on the newsstand and it had great articles and pics, I would subscribe.
15%
 15%  [ 11 ]
Total Votes : 70

i think this would definitely be a hit in hawaii at least where most of the fan base doesnt speak or know any korean at all. the best way to advertise it too would be on kbfd too in that 750-9 timeslot everyday because even though ppl on forums say yes... i would think most of the fan base here in hawaii consist of the 40+ club that dont go to internet forums, but just lovvvveee watching korean dramas. i have a lot of aunties that are my parents age that watch them... so if you can get that fan base to buy the mags then definitely it would be worth publishing especially if it has mostly everythings that ppl have suggested here... definitely has to be mostly in color too would be good hehe
